AI Technical Summary
In existing electric steamers, the heating plate is fixedly connected to the base, which makes cleaning inconvenient and poses safety hazards.
A detachable heating plate structure was designed. Electrical connection is achieved by plugging the base electrical connector and the heating plate electrical connector. The heating plate is supported by a support rod. The base and the heating plate can be separated for easy cleaning and improved safety during use.
The heating plate and base are separable, making cleaning easier and improving safety. The support rod enhances the load-bearing capacity of the heating plate and protects the electrical connections.

[Technical Field]
[0001] This utility model relates to an electric steamer. [Background Technology]
[0002] In existing electric steamers, the base and heating plate are fixedly connected, and the heating plate cannot be separated from the base, which poses problems such as inconvenience in cleaning and safety hazards. [Utility Model Content]
[0003] This invention overcomes the shortcomings of the prior art and provides an electric steamer.
[0004] To achieve the above objectives, the present invention adopts the following technical solution:
[0005] An electric steamer, characterized in that: it includes a base, a base cavity on the base, a detachable heating plate inside the base cavity, a base electrical connector and a plurality of support rods for supporting the heating plate on the bottom surface of the inner side of the base cavity, and a heating plate electrical connector at the bottom of the heating plate that is plugged into the base electrical connector.
[0006] An electric steamer as described above is characterized in that: a separable heat insulation plate is provided on the base in the base cavity, the heat insulation plate is provided with a first heat insulation plate through hole for the base electrical connector to pass through, and a support rod is arranged in the heat insulation plate.
[0007] An electric steamer as described above is characterized in that: the bottom surface of the heating plate is provided with support members respectively corresponding to the support rod.
[0008] An electric steamer as described above is characterized in that: the support member includes a U-shaped support portion connected to a support rod, and the upper ends of both sides of the U-shaped support portion are respectively provided with connecting portions connected to the bottom surface of the heat insulation plate.
[0009] An electric steamer as described above is characterized in that: a base positioning protrusion is provided on the bottom surface of the inner side of the base cavity, and a heat insulation plate positioning recess is provided on the bottom surface of the heat insulation plate to cooperate with the base positioning protrusion.
[0010] An electric steamer as described above is characterized in that: a heat-insulating buffer strip is provided on the upper end of the side of the heat-insulating plate.
[0011] An electric steamer as described above is characterized in that: a heat insulation plate groove is provided on the upper side of the heat insulation plate, and a heat insulation buffer strip is provided in the heat insulation plate groove.
[0012] An electric steamer as described above is characterized in that: base recesses are provided on both sides of the base, and handles are provided on both sides of the heating plate at positions corresponding to the base recesses.
[0013] The beneficial effects of this utility model are:
[0014] This utility model features a detachable heating plate within a recessed cavity of the base. An electrical connector and multiple support rods for supporting the heating plate are located on the bottom inner side of the cavity. A heating plate electrical connector, which plugs into the electrical connector, is located at the bottom of the heating plate. This design allows for the detachable arrangement of the base and heating plate, facilitating cleaning. Furthermore, the electrical connection between the base and heating plate via the electrical connector enhances safety. The support rods also increase the load-bearing capacity of the heating plate and protect both the electrical connectors. [Image Description]

[0021] like Figure 1-4As shown, an electric steamer includes a base 1 with a base cavity 11. A detachable heating plate 2 is housed within the base cavity 11. A base electrical connector 3 and multiple support rods 4 for supporting the heating plate 2 are located on the inner bottom surface of the base cavity 11. A heating plate electrical connector 5, which is plugged into the base electrical connector 3, is located at the bottom of the heating plate 2. After the heating plate 2 is inserted into the base cavity 11 of the base 1, the heating plate electrical connector 5 at the bottom of the heating plate 2 plugs into the base electrical connector 3 on the base 1 to achieve electrical connection, allowing the base 1 to supply power to the heating plate 2. This allows the base 1 and the heating plate 2 to be detachably connected, facilitating cleaning and improving safety during use. Simultaneously, the support rods 4 support the heating plate 2, increasing its load-bearing capacity and protecting both the base electrical connector 3 and the heating plate electrical connector 5.
[0022] like Figure 2-4 As shown, a separable heat insulation plate 6 is provided on the base 1 within the base cavity 11. The heat insulation plate 6 has a first heat insulation plate through hole 61 through which the base electrical connector 3 passes. The support rod 4 is set inside the heat insulation plate 6. The heat insulation plate 6 reduces heat conduction between the heating plate 2 and the base 1, thus protecting the base 1.
[0023] like Figure 2-4 As shown, the bottom surface of the heating plate 2 is provided with support members 7 respectively corresponding to the support rod 4; the support member 7 includes a U-shaped support part 71 connected to the support rod 4, and the upper ends of both sides of the U-shaped support part 71 are respectively provided with connecting parts 72 connected to the bottom surface of the heat insulation plate 6, so as to better support the heating plate 2.
[0024] like Figure 2-4 As shown, a base positioning protrusion 12 is provided on the bottom surface of the inner side of the base cavity 11, and a heat insulation plate positioning recess 62 is provided on the bottom surface of the heat insulation plate 6 to cooperate with the base positioning protrusion 12, so that the heat insulation plate 6 is positioned and installed in the base cavity 11 of the base 1.
[0025] like Figure 3 As shown, a heat insulation buffer strip 8 is provided on the upper side of the heat insulation plate 6, and a heat insulation plate groove 63 is provided on the upper side of the heat insulation plate 6. The heat insulation buffer strip 8 is set in the heat insulation plate groove 63, so that the heat insulation buffer strip 8 is positioned and installed on the upper side of the heat insulation plate 6 to achieve heat insulation buffering between it and the heating plate 2.
[0026] like Figure 1 As shown, the base 1 has base recesses 13 on both sides, and the heating plate 2 has handles 9 on both sides corresponding to the base recesses 13, which makes it easy to pick up and put down the heating plate 2.

Claims
1. An electric steamer characterized by: It includes a base (1), a base cavity (11) on the base (1), a separable heating plate (2) inside the base cavity (11), a base electrical connector (3) on the bottom inner side of the base cavity (11) and a plurality of support rods (4) for supporting the heating plate (2), and a heating plate electrical connector (5) at the bottom of the heating plate (2) that is plugged into the base electrical connector (3).
2. An electric steamer as claimed in claim 1, wherein: A separable heat insulation plate (6) is provided on the base (1) in the base cavity (11). The heat insulation plate (6) is provided with a first heat insulation plate through hole (61) through which the base electrical connector (3) passes. The support rod (4) is set in the heat insulation plate (6).
3. An electric steamer as claimed in claim 2, wherein: The bottom surface of the heating plate (2) is provided with support members (7) that are respectively set in relation to the support rod (4).
4. An electric steamer as claimed in claim 3, wherein: The support member (7) includes a U-shaped support part (71) connected to the support rod (4), and the upper ends of the U-shaped support part (71) are respectively provided with connecting parts (72) connected to the bottom surface of the heat insulation plate (6).
5. An electric steamer as claimed in claim 2, wherein: The base cavity (11) has a base positioning protrusion (12) on the bottom surface inside, and the heat insulation plate (6) has a heat insulation plate positioning recess (62) on the bottom surface that cooperates with the base positioning protrusion (12).
6. An electric steamer as claimed in claim 2, wherein: The upper side of the heat insulation plate (6) is provided with a heat insulation buffer strip (8).
7. An electric steamer as claimed in claim 6 wherein: The upper side of the heat insulation plate (6) is provided with a heat insulation plate groove (63), and the heat insulation buffer strip (8) is set in the heat insulation plate groove (63).
8. The electric steamer according to claim 1, wherein: The base (1) has base recesses (13) on both sides, and the heating plate (2) has handles (9) on both sides corresponding to the base recesses (13).
